What Is a Plumbing Emergency in King of Prussia?

First, let's define what truly counts as an emergency. A plumbing emergency is any sudden problem that threatens your home's safety, causes major water damage, or makes your plumbing unusable. In our area, with its mix of historic homes and modern developments, emergencies often look like this:

  • Burst or Frozen Pipes: During heavy winter freezes in King of Prussia, pipes in older neighborhoods like Henderson Road or along the Schuylkill River can freeze and burst. This is especially common in homes built before 1980 that might still have galvanized steel pipes.
  • Severe Sewer Backups: When our region gets those heavy summer thunderstorms, the ground can become saturated. For homes in lower-lying areas or with older clay sewer lines, this often means sewage backing up into basements—a serious health hazard.
  • Major Water Leaks: A broken water heater in your King of Prussia townhouse or a failed pressure valve can flood areas quickly. Given how many homes here have finished basements, even an inch of water can ruin carpets, drywall, and personal belongings.
  • Complete Loss of Water: If your main water line breaks—perhaps due to shifting soil or tree roots common in our area—your entire home loses water. No flushing toilets, no showers, no cooking water.
  • Gas Line Issues: If you smell gas near any plumbing appliance, this is always an emergency. Evacuate immediately and call from outside.

What's not usually an emergency? A slow-draining sink, a running toilet, or a dripping faucet. These can typically wait for normal business hours.

When Should You Call an Emergency Plumber in King of Prussia?

Knowing when to make that urgent call can prevent thousands in damage. Here are clear signs you need immediate help:

Call Right Now If:

  • You have more than an inch of standing water anywhere in your home
  • Raw sewage is coming up through drains or toilets
  • You hear water running inside walls when all fixtures are off
  • Your water heater is leaking significantly
  • You have no water at all in the house
  • Pipes have frozen and you cannot thaw them safely

It Can Probably Wait Until Morning If:

  • One toilet is clogged but others work
  • A faucet has a small, steady drip
  • Your water pressure seems slightly lower than usual
  • A drain is slow but still functional

In King of Prussia, where winter temperatures regularly drop below freezing, a frozen pipe becomes an emergency much faster than in warmer climates. Don't wait until it bursts—if you can't get water flowing safely, call for help.

What Does an Emergency Plumber Cost in King of Prussia, PA?

This is the question we hear most often: "How much will this cost?" Let's break it down honestly.

Yes, emergency plumbers do cost more than scheduling during regular hours. You're paying for immediate response, often outside normal business hours. In the King of Prussia area, here's what you can typically expect:

  • Emergency Call-Out Fee: Most local companies charge between $100 and $200 just to come to your home after hours, on weekends, or holidays. This covers their immediate dispatch and travel.
  • Hourly Labor Rates: Expect to pay $150 to $250 per hour for emergency service, compared to $90 to $150 for regular appointments.
  • Common Emergency Repair Costs:
    • Fixing a burst pipe: $300 to $1,000+ depending on location and pipe material
    • Clearing a severe sewer line clog: $400 to $1,200
    • Water heater emergency replacement: $1,200 to $2,500
    • Main water line repair: $1,000 to $3,000

Why are emergency plumbers more expensive? They maintain 24/7 staffing, specialized equipment ready to go at any hour, and vehicles stocked with parts for common local issues. For King of Prussia homes, that might mean having PEX piping supplies for newer developments or knowing how to work with the copper pipes common in mid-century neighborhoods.

The total cost depends on several factors specific to our area:

  • Time of Day: Midnight calls cost more than 6 PM calls
  • Day of Week: Weekends and holidays have premium rates
  • Complexity: A burst pipe in an easy-to-access crawl space costs less than one inside a finished wall in your King of Prussia condo
  • Parts Needed: Some older homes in historic districts may require special fittings

Most reputable emergency plumbers in our area will give you a clear estimate before starting work. Be wary of anyone who can't provide at least a range of what your repair might cost.

How to Get an Emergency Plumber and What to Do Until They Arrive

When disaster strikes, follow these steps:

  1. Shut Off the Water: Know where your main shut-off valve is. In many King of Prussia homes, it's in the basement or near the water heater. Turn it clockwise until tight.
  2. Turn Off the Water Heater: If you have a gas water heater, turn it to "pilot" mode. For electric, switch it off at the breaker.
  3. Address Minor Leaks: Use towels, buckets, or even duct tape for temporary containment.
  4. Call for Help: Have your address ready and describe the problem clearly: "Water spraying from pipe under kitchen sink" or "Sewage backing up into basement shower."
  5. Clear a Path: Move furniture and valuables away from the affected area. Emergency plumbers need clear access to work safely and efficiently.
  6. Document the Damage: Take photos for insurance purposes before starting cleanup.

For frozen pipes (common during our cold snaps), never use an open flame to thaw them. A hairdryer on low heat is safer, but if the pipe has already burst, you'll need professional help.

Local Factors That Affect Plumbing Emergencies in King of Prussia

Our specific location and climate create unique plumbing challenges:

Winter Freezes: King of Prussia averages about 25 inches of snow annually, with temperatures often dropping into the teens. Pipes in unheated spaces—like crawl spaces, garages, or exterior walls—are at high risk. Homes with pipes running along exterior walls, common in many older neighborhoods, need special attention.

Summer Storms: Our humid summers bring heavy thunderstorms that can overwhelm sewer systems. Combined sewer systems in some older parts of town can back up into basements during heavy rain.

Soil Conditions: The clay-heavy soil in our area expands when wet and contracts when dry. This shifting can stress underground pipes, leading to cracks or misalignments in sewer and water lines.

Building Types:

  • Historic Homes: Properties in older areas may have galvanized steel pipes that corrode from the inside out, leading to sudden failures.
  • Modern Developments: Newer construction often uses PEX piping, which is less likely to burst from freezing but can have fitting failures.
  • Townhouses and Condos: Shared walls mean a leak in your unit can quickly affect neighbors, requiring immediate attention.

Local Regulations: King of Prussia and Upper Merion Township have specific codes for plumbing repairs, especially in flood zones or historic districts. A local emergency plumber will know these requirements.

Preventing Plumbing Emergencies in Your King of Prussia Home

While not all emergencies can be prevented, regular maintenance reduces your risk significantly:

  • Fall Preparation: Before winter, disconnect garden hoses, drain irrigation systems, and insulate pipes in unheated areas. This is especially important for homes with pools or extensive landscaping.
  • Water Heater Maintenance: Drain a few gallons from your water heater annually to remove sediment—a common issue with our mineral-rich water.
  • Tree Root Management: If you have large trees near your sewer line, consider annual inspections. Willow trees, common along our waterways, are particularly thirsty for sewer lines.
  • Sump Pump Testing: If you have a basement, test your sump pump before rainy seasons. Many King of Prussia homes need these due to our water table.
  • Know Your System: Learn where your main shut-off valve is and how to use it. Label it clearly so anyone in your household can find it in an emergency.

Insurance and Emergency Plumbing Repairs

Most homeowner's insurance policies cover "sudden and accidental" water damage, but not necessarily the repair of the failed plumbing component itself. For example, if a burst pipe floods your kitchen, insurance typically covers the water damage to floors and cabinets, but you might pay for the pipe repair.

Important steps for insurance claims:

  • Document everything with photos before, during, and after repairs
  • Keep all receipts and invoices
  • Get a detailed report from your plumber explaining the cause
  • Contact your insurance company promptly—many have time limits for reporting claims

Some King of Prussia homeowners add specific water backup coverage to their policies, which is wise given our occasional heavy rains and aging infrastructure in some neighborhoods.
